Previous field courses were held in:

Colombia (2023)

Primary partner: Center for Research on Sustainable Agricultural Production Systems (CIPAV)

This course was held at two landscapes in the Valle del Cauca region: El Hatico Nature Reserve and the Smallholder Community of Bellavista. Over six days, participants deepened their understanding of sustainable land use and restoration by visiting demonstration sites, learning about agroforestry, silvopastoral and restoration practices, and understanding the role of participatory research and generational exchange. By interacting with farmers and local community members who have transitioned to sustainable land use practices and committed to conservation, participants learned about the values and motivations of people who have worked hard to enhance their livelihoods and the environment.

Panama (2023)

Primary partners: Achotines Research Station and the Association of Livestock; Agro-Silvopastoral Producers of Pedasí (APASPE)

Panama's Azuero Peninsula is a largely deforested dry tropical ecosystem comprised of a mosaic landscape of cattle ranching, subsistence and commercial agriculture, tourism development and forest fragments.  On a variety of interpretive trails, research sites, demonstration areas, and silvopastoral model farms, participants engaged in hands-on field activities and interacted with local landowners and community associations to learn firsthand about motives, strategies, and challenges for land management decisions.

Philippines (2020 & 2023)

Primary partner: Visayas State University (VSU)

On the island of Leyte, the landscape is largely dominated by the production of corn, coconuts, sugarcane and irrigated rice. Participants deepened their understanding of tropical forest ecology by visiting a Key Biodiversity Area, learning about the origins of the native species reforestation approach called Rainforestation, visiting demonstration sites, conducting a site assessment, propagating forest tree species, helping develop a Rainforestation site, and learning about ongoing research and applied conservation and restoration efforts. They will also learn how the Rainforestation process addresses complex land tenure and other governance challenges. Participants will interact with local community members and community organizers who have implemented Rainforestation to understand their motives and experiences.
